Vue and Axios create a modern front-end application development workflow

With the rapid development of the Internet, the needs of front-end applications are becoming more and more diverse and complex. In order to improve development efficiency and user experience, many developers choose to use Vue and Axios, two popular libraries, to build modern front-end applications. This article will introduce how to use Vue and Axios to create an efficient front-end application development workflow, and provide some practical code examples.

Vue is a progressive framework for building user interfaces. Its design goal is to gradually use reusable components to build large applications. Vue's core library only focuses on the view layer and is very easy to integrate with other libraries or existing projects. Its responsive data binding and componentized system allow developers to easily build high-quality user interfaces.

Axios is a Promise-based HTTP client that can send HTTP requests in browsers and Node.js, and supports back-end interface calls and data transmission. Features of Axios include ease of use, scalability, and elegant error handling mechanisms, which make it the first choice of many developers.

The following is some sample code using Vue and Axios to build a simple user management system.

First install Vue and Axios:

npm install vue axios --save

Introduce axios into the Vue component and use:

<template>
  <div>
    <input v-model="username" placeholder="请输入用户名" />
    <input v-model="password" placeholder="请输入密码" />
    <button @click="login">登录</button>
    <div v-if="response">{{ response }}</div>
  </div>
</template>

<script>
import axios from 'axios';

export default {
  data() {
    return {
      username: '',
      password: '',
      response: ''
    };
  },
  methods: {
    login() {
      const url = 'http://api.example.com/login';
      const data = {
        username: this.username,
        password: this.password
      };
      axios.post(url, data)
        .then(response => {
          this.response = response.data;
        })
        .catch(error => {
          this.response = error.message;
        });
    }
  }
};
</script>

In the above code, we use axios to send a POST request to the specified URL , and pass the username and password as the request body. Then, in the success callback function, we store the data returned by the server in the component's response property. If an error occurs, we store the error information in the response.

The above example demonstrates how to use Vue and Axios to perform user login operations, obtain data returned by the server, and display it on the page. You can extend and modify the code according to your needs.

In addition to sending HTTP requests, Axios also provides a rich API to handle requests and responses, including request interception, response interception, request cancellation, setting default parameters, etc. By properly utilizing the various functions of Axios, you can better handle complex application scenarios and business logic.
